Synthesis of new betaine-type amphoteric surfactants from tall oil fatty acid

Abstract

Two new betaine-type amphoteric surfactants — betaineN,N'-dihydroxyethyl-N-ethyl fatty acid ester and ammoniumN-(fatty acid ester) ethyl-N,N-bis (2-hydroxyethyl)-3-(2-hydroxypropyl) sulfonate — were synthesized using tall oil fatty acids as the raw materials. Processing conditions suitable for synthesizing the intermediates and final products were probed. In addition, the chemical structures of the intermediates and the final products were identified by infrared spectroscopy, hydrogen nuclear magnetic resonance spectroscopy, and elemental analysis.
